Bug ID: 502595 Summary: Merkuro Calendar crashes when editing events Classification: Applications Product: Merkuro Version: 24.12.3 Platform: Arch Linux OS: Linux Status: REPORTED Severity: crash Priority: NOR Component: general Assignee: claudio.cam...@kde.org Reporter: k...@jrtberlin.de CC: c...@carlschwan.eu Target Milestone: --- Created attachment 180110 --> https://bugs.kde.org/attachment.cgi?id=180110&action=edit gdb log SUMMARY When I edit calendar entries that contain addresses in Merkuro Calendar the process crashes. I can reproducibly crash merkuro 24.12.3 on Arch, when I enter the location: "Hörsaal 1B, Rost- und Silberlaube, 14195 Berlin" as a location. ST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Create a new calendar entry with the location "Hörsaal 1B, Rost- und Silberlaube, 14195 Berlin" 2. Edit the created entry 3. crash OBSERVED RESULT The layout in the edit view is messed up, shortly after the application crashes. EXPECTED RESULT The event is displayed without layered ui elements and the applications doesn't crash.
